@eidos.space/eidos-file-ui
React provider, view host, and reusable editors for the open Eidos File format.
Install
pnpm add @eidos.space/[email protected] \
@eidos.space/[email protected] \
@glideapps/glide-data-grid marked@^4 react react-domImport the precompiled stylesheet once. Consumers do not need Tailwind.
import "@eidos.space/eidos-file-ui/styles.css"Embed a view host
Create an EidosFileSession with a host adapter, then provide it to React.

}The host owns file selection, session cleanup, view switching, and conflict UI. The view host owns only rendering and public data operations.
Build a view
Custom views receive a typed table, persisted view descriptor, normalized query, async data source, selection, local view state, commands, and explicit capabilities.

Trust and capabilities
React views are trusted, statically imported host code. This package is not an
extension sandbox. The props contract intentionally does not expose raw file
bytes, native filesystem access, SQLite, application routes, stores, or IPC.
capabilities.rawFile and capabilities.nativeFileSystem are always false.
Styles and theme
styles.css contains the utilities used by the package and scoped Eidos theme
tokens. EidosFileProvider applies the [data-eidos-file-root] boundary and
supports themeName="light" | "dark". Hosts can override CSS variables on that
element without copying Eidos global CSS.
